Alexandria Police Charge Man with Two Bank Robberies

Leo Canega

ALEXANDRIA, VA – The Alexandria Police Department has recently charged Jaquan Royal, a 27-year-old resident of Prince George’s County, Maryland, in connection with two local bank robberies. Royal is accused of the March 23, 2023, robbery in the 3500 block of Mount Vernon Avenue, and the April 3, 2023, robbery in the 400 block of John Carlyle Street. He is currently being held at an adult detention center in another jurisdiction.

No injuries were reported in either incident. The Alexandria Police Department is encouraging anyone with information to contact Detective Brattelli at (703) 746-6699, or via email at john.brattelli@alexandriava.gov.
